100s show up for Easter Bunny photos, eggs

Under sunny skies and warm temperatures, the Canyon Lake Family Matters Club held its annual Easter Egg-stravaganza on Saturday at Holiday Harbor.

With over 250 children signed up for photos, as well as about 30 more who dropped by, the Easter Bunny photo booths were busy with picture-taking activity during the two-hour event.

Additionally, over 3,000 eggs were gathered at the Easter Egg Hunt by hundreds of festively-dressed Canyon Lake kids. Each child also left with a special toy and/or craft.

 

“Thank you to all our Family Matters Club volunteers for all their hard work,” organizer Shawna Bowen said. “and a special thank you to our two Easter Bunnies, Trey Bowen and Donna Lovejoy (aka Grandma Bunny).”

Because the Easter event this year had to be put on with social distancing in mind, the club decided this year to have photos with the Easter Bunny taken by family members. Family Matters Club hosted the event free of charge.
